Sat 761172003956015

decimal
152234.2003956015
degree
0°152234′1034″2003956015‴
percentile
36.246285942538314%
name
ilodqyobfda
cycle
0
epoch
0
period
75
block
152234
offset
2003956015
timestamp
rarity
common